The Open-Source Evolution of Geometry Dash on GitHub Geometry Dash, the rhythm-based platformer created by RobTop Games, has maintained massive global popularity since 2013. While the official game offers thousands of developer-made levels, its longevity is heavily driven by its community. On GitHub, developers and fans have built an expansive open-source ecosystem that changes how the game is played, modded, and analyzed.
The modding community on GitHub is active and innovative. Mod menus (also called hack packs) are among the most popular projects, allowing players to customize their game, practice difficult sections, and add quality-of-life features.

When official updates stalled between versions 2.1 and 2.2, the community relied on Geometry Dash Private Servers (GDPS). These are independent server architectures that mimic RobTop’s official database, allowing users to host custom levels, rate systems, and community hubs. geometry dash github
Geometry Dash levels are stored as highly compressed, encrypted strings of object data. GitHub developers have successfully cracked this format, opening the door for external level analysis and creation tools. Level Translators and Generators
